Dub J drops sultry new visuals for Sielle-assisted “No Sleep”

No Sleep: Dub J enlists Sielle for new single

Canadian producer Dub J continues the promotional campaign for his next project with the new “No Sleep” video.

The sultry and vibrant new release – featuring Toronto-based Montréalaise Sielle and powered by Toronto director, The Knemesis – follows the lead single “Dynamite” (featuring Témi) which we posted a couple of weeks ago. Both tracks were written by Mississauga recording artist, JD Era, and will be featured on the Blame Me album.

“There’s a common theme this summer. BLAME Dub J for the music.”

Blame Me is scheduled to drop on Aug. 10 and will be available on all major streaming platforms. More singles (possibly videos) are expected to drop before the release date.
